Description
HTCondor is an effective tool to rank and match execute resources against a set of jobs with explicit resource requirements. In the cloud, a subtly different challenge is presented: how to rank execute resource configurations that will be automatically created to run idle jobs (auto-scaled on-demand).
We describe recent work by the HTCondor team and Google Cloud to provide built-in support for commonly desired patterns in cloud auto-scaling. For example, a job can require co-location of execute resources with data stored as Google Cloud Storage objects. Alternatively, a group of jobs might seek to expand into as many cloud regions as possible in search of cost savings or to minimize the wall-clock time of a particular workflow.
